Are your kids good readers?
Nationally, kids' reading skills are eroding quicker than a sand dune in a
windstorm. Eighth graders have plateaued and 12th-graders have lost ground
in their reading abilities. What can you do to help your kids' reading? Be
a role model: read yourself. And make a daily habit of reading to, or
with, your kids. Set a time each day when TVs, computers, and video games
are off limits, and give your kids rewards for reading during this time.
Make "library dates" with your kids, and help them find books or magazines
on subjects they like.
Family Day 2006
Governor Jeb Bush has declared Monday, September 26, as Family Day – A Day
to Eat Dinner with Your Children. This event is aimed at promoting the
value of family interaction as a means of preventing and reducing
substance abuse among young people.
